How do you cook baked beans on the grill?
Instructions
- Preheat the grill at medium-high heat.
- Place a cast iron skillet on the grill.
- Add the garlic, stir; cook for 30 seconds.
- Add the beans, tomato sauce, ketchup, mustard, vinegar, chili powder and paprika; stir.
- Season with salt and pepper.
- Cook on the grill for 15-20 minutes.
- Serve and enjoy!

How do I make baked beans thicker?
How to Thicken Baked Beans
- Remove 1 cup of beans, mash them with a fork, return them to the pot, and stir to combine.
- Make a slurry of 2 tablespoons of cornstarch and 2 tablespoons of cold water.
- Use 2 tablespoons flour mixed with 1/4 cup cold water for each cup of liquid to be thickened.

How do I make canned beans tasty?
Toss drained/rinsed/dried beans with a bit of olive oil (or avocado oil) and your favorite seasonings. You can add crushed whole seeds (coriander, cumin, fennel, mustard, etc.), woodsy herbs (thyme, oregano, rosemary, sage), red pepper flakes, crushed garlic cloves, and of course salt and pepper.
Why do my baked beans come out hard?
The most common reason for hard beans are old and poor quality beans. Apart from that, the types of beans, the cooking time, and using hard water can keep your beans hard after cooking. Another interesting reason is adding acidic ingredients. These are the reasons responsible for keeping your beans hard after cooking.
